Transaction 31ecae489c7e18c13c876c5536475f38373d646f3420d0e239a04af238b5cdfc

1 Input
2 Outputs
  • 31ecae489c7e18c13c876c5536475f38373d646f3420d0e239a04af238b5cdfc:0
  • value  4270740
    address  3DPL8N4twLbm7RKxkCjU95L9gLCGGbT6wa
  • 31ecae489c7e18c13c876c5536475f38373d646f3420d0e239a04af238b5cdfc:1
  • value  20645
    address  bc1qcfpwyf0jrfwntcj0cqlyf766fykeas2mjem3uz